Plot: Ada, a young girl about 10 years of age has a club foot due to which her cruel mother decides to lock her up in the room her whole life. The only person she has interacted with is her little brother Jamie who she feeds and takes care of until he starts school. World War 2 is around the corner and Hilter is going to start bombing England so, all the parents decide to send their kids away even though Mam(Ada’s mother_Which mother tells her own kids to call her mam) plans to send Jamie not Ada but both kids escape and make their way to the countryside and are reluctantly taken in by Susan, a recluse who has issues of her own. Susan, Ada, and Jamie should overcome their struggles and learn to live happily with what they have.

➴ Amazing plot idea
I personally adored the plot. The idea of bringing together a disabled abused girl, a little scared boy, and an isolated lady is amazing.
➴ Wonderful execution and writing
The book focuses on a lot of things: struggles, club foot, atrocious mom, trust issues, stereotypes, friendship, and Love then there is ‘hope’ for a better life. The author managed to talk about each and every point without overdoing it with emotions and stuff, she flawlessly balances everything. She makes sure we don’t start to preach Sympathy to Ada rather we give support.
➴ Tension
There is so much tension that’s how I felt reading the book, tense about what will happen next, so tense I read this book in one day(Yes, one day don’t come after me).
➴ Ponies
When I say ponies don’t think about anything cutesy, it's not. I like the way the author uses Ada’s love for(riding) ponies as a symbol of freedom
➴ No stereotypes to be found
Whenever an author writes a book against stereotypes he/she unintentionally lets their character slip into a stereotype but our author doesn't make that mistake I honestly thought Margaret(daughter of the rich lady) would be the mean girl with an inflated ego but she isn’t, I’m honestly surprised but still happy
